摘要
This paper proposes a five degrees-of-freedom measurement system for measuring geometric errors of the rotary axis. To align the measured rotary axis with the reference axis, a diode laser is used to represent the rotary axis of the measured rotation stage. Based on the proposed measurement system, a model for separating the position independent geometric errors and position dependent geometric errors of the measured rotary axis from the measured value is established and verified by measurement experiments. The results of measurement experiments repeated for five times show that the measurement uncertainty of the proposed measurement system is less than +/- 1.6 mu m for radial motion, the measurement uncertainty is less than +/- 1.7 arc sec for tilt motion, and the measurement uncertainty is less than +/- 1.3 arc sec for angle position.
